How Our Residential Water Removal Process Works
Our team will guide you through every step of the process, from initial assessment to final cleanup. We’ll explain what to expect, so you can plan accordingly. Our goal is to make this stressful experience as seamless as possible. Here’s what you can expect:
Step 1: Initial Assessment
Our crew will arrive within 60 minutes to assess the damage and create a customized plan. We’ll identify the source of the water, check for structural damage, and find out the best course of action. Fast and thorough assessment accurate damage assessment clear communication.
Step 2: Water Extraction
We’ll use powerful pumps and wet vacuums to remove standing water and extract water from carpets, upholstery, and drywall. Our team will work efficiently to reduce downtime and prevent further damage. Quick water removal thorough extraction minimal disruption.
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ification
We’ll use industrial-grade dehumidifiers and fans to dry your space and prevent mold growth. Our team will monitor humidity levels and adjust equipment as needed to ensure a thorough dry-out. Effective drying prevention of mold growth fast return to normal.
Step 4: Cleaning and Sanitizing
We’ll clean and sanitize all affected areas, including carpets, upholstery, and hard surfaces. Our team will use eco-friendly cleaning products and equipment to ensure a safe and healthy environment. Thorough cleaning sanitizing for safety eco-friendly cleaning products.
Step 5: Restoration and Reconstruction
Our team will work with you to restore your property to its original condition. We’ll repair or replace damaged materials, and our crew will ensure a seamless transition back to normal. Professional restoration expert reconstruction seamless transition.

Residential Water Removal v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Small leak in a bathroom | Yes | No | Easy to fix with basic tools and knowledge. |
| Basement flood from heavy rainfall | No | Yes | Needs specialized equipment and expertise to dry and restore. |
| Water damage from a burst pipe | No | Yes | Needs immediate attention to prevent further damage and potential health risks. |
| Musty odors in a crawlspace | No | Yes | Shows hidden water damage and potential mold growth. |
| Water stains on walls and ceilings | No | Yes | Shows hidden water damage and potential structural issues. |
| High humidity levels in a home | No | Yes | Shows hidden water damage and potential mold growth. |

Residential Water Removal Cost in Shakopee, MN
The cost of Residential Water Removal varies based on the severity, size of the affected area, and local conditions in Shakopee, MN. Our estimates are free and based on a thorough assessment of your property. Here are some typical price ranges for common services:
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water Extraction |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, equipment needed. |
| Drying and Dehumidification | $1,000 – $5,000 | Size of affected area, number of dehumidifiers needed, equipment rental costs. |
| Cleaning and Sanitizing | $500 – $2,000 | Size of affected area, type of cleaning products and equipment needed. |
| Restoration and Reconstruction | $2,000 – $10,000 | Size of affected area, type of materials needed, labor costs. |
